There are usually two ways to convert a PDF to text, and both have a downside. Desktop software means downloading and installing a program, which you often cannot do on a work or public computer, and which leaves something on the machine afterwards. Typical online converters skip the install but upload your file to their servers to process it, so a private document leaves your control even if only briefly.
FixTools is a third option. It is an online tool, so there is nothing to install, but it does the reading with pdf.js inside your own browser rather than on a server, so the file never leaves the device. You get the no-install convenience of a web tool with the privacy of a local program. The only thing it cannot do is read a scanned PDF, since those are page images with no text layer, and the OCR PDF tool handles that case.

Confirm it stays local
After the page loads, you can disconnect from the network and the extraction still runs, proving nothing is uploaded.
